Location and Time

The location of the accident plays a significant role in understanding its impact. Was it on a major highway, a busy intersection, or a residential street? The location can tell us a lot about potential traffic disruptions and the severity of the accident. For instance, an accident on a highway might lead to significant delays and detours, affecting a large number of commuters. On the other hand, an accident in a residential area could pose risks to pedestrians and local residents.

The time of the accident is equally important. Accidents during rush hour can cause massive traffic jams, while those occurring late at night might indicate different factors, such as impaired driving or reduced visibility. Knowing the time helps in analyzing the circumstances and potential causes of the accident. It also helps authorities in managing traffic flow and responding effectively.

Vehicles Involved

Next up, the number of vehicles involved is a critical detail. Was it a single-car accident, a fender-bender with two cars, or a multi-vehicle pile-up? Each scenario presents different challenges and requires different approaches. A single-car accident might suggest issues with the driver or the vehicle itself, while a multi-vehicle accident could indicate hazardous road conditions or driver error involving multiple parties. Understanding the scope of the accident helps in assessing the potential damage and injuries.

Traffic Delays

One of the most immediate and noticeable consequences of a car accident is traffic delays. When an accident occurs, especially on a major road, it can cause significant congestion. Emergency responders need time to arrive, assess the situation, and clear the scene. This process can lead to long backups, making it difficult for commuters to get to work, school, or other important appointments. Traffic delays can also affect public transportation, delivery services, and other time-sensitive operations.

To avoid being caught in traffic delays, it's a good idea to check traffic reports before heading out. Use navigation apps like Google Maps or Waze to get real-time updates on road conditions and potential delays. If possible, consider alternative routes or modes of transportation to minimize disruption to your schedule. Staying informed and planning ahead can save you a lot of time and frustration.

Emotional Distress

The emotional distress caused by car accidents is often underestimated. Even if physical injuries are minor, the psychological impact can be significant. Victims may experience anxiety, fear, and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). The trauma of being involved in an accident can linger for a long time, affecting their ability to drive, work, and engage in daily activities.

Support from friends, family, and mental health professionals can be invaluable in these situations. Counseling and therapy can help victims process their emotions and develop coping strategies. It's important to recognize that emotional healing takes time, and seeking help is a sign of strength, not weakness. Encouraging open communication and providing a supportive environment can make a big difference in the recovery process.

Defensive Driving

Next up, defensive driving is a proactive approach to safety that involves anticipating potential hazards and taking steps to avoid them. This means being aware of your surroundings, paying attention to other drivers, and being prepared to react to unexpected situations. Defensive driving techniques can help you avoid accidents even when other drivers make mistakes.

Some key elements of defensive driving include maintaining a safe following distance, scanning the road ahead for potential hazards, and being prepared to brake or swerve to avoid a collision. It also means being aware of your own limitations and avoiding distractions like cell phones or eating while driving. By practicing defensive driving, you can significantly reduce your risk of being involved in a car accident.

Vehicle Maintenance

Regular vehicle maintenance is another crucial aspect of car accident prevention. A well-maintained vehicle is less likely to experience mechanical failures that could lead to accidents. This includes checking your tires, brakes, lights, and fluids regularly. Addressing any issues promptly can prevent them from escalating into more serious problems.

Make sure to follow the manufacturer's recommended maintenance schedule for your vehicle. This includes routine oil changes, tire rotations, and inspections. If you notice anything unusual, such as strange noises or warning lights, take your car to a qualified mechanic for evaluation. Keeping your vehicle in good condition is not only essential for safety but also for its longevity and performance.
